#385018 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#385018 is composed of 22% red, 31.4%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30% cyan, 0% magenta, 70%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 85.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 20.4%. #385018 color hex could be obtained by blending #70a030 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#385018

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030501 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#385018

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353830 is the less saturated color, while #3b6800 is the most saturated one.
